2007-11-07 Thread Steven Flatt
Postgres 8.2.4. Would this be considered a bug or is the tablespace info excluded for a particular reason? # CREATE TABLESPACE foo_space LOCATION '/some/dir'; # CREATE TABLE foo (a int); # CREATE INDEX foo_idx ON foo(a) TABLESPACE foo_space; # SELECT pg_get_indexdef(oid) FROM pg_class WHERE reln
